The Home Equity Sharing Agreement template for Realtors in Collin facilitates collaborative investment in residential property by outlining the terms between two parties, referred to as Alpha and Beta. This document specifies purchase details, including the purchase price, down payment distribution, and financing amounts. It also addresses the responsibilities of each party regarding property maintenance, tax payments, and the sharing of proceeds upon sale. The template encourages clear communication between involved parties, ensuring that any future modifications are documented and agreed upon. Additionally, it stipulates procedures for handling disputes through mandatory arbitration, adding a layer of security for users. Home equity sharing agreements involve selling a percentage of your home's value or appreciation to an investor in exchange for a lump sum upfront. The agreement typically is settled, with the homeowner paying back the investor, after the home is sold or at the end of a 10- to 30-year period.

Equity sharing is another name for shared ownership or co-ownership. It takes one property, more than one owner, and blends them to maximize profit and tax deductions.
